Why CHAs need a Combo DSC

Custom House Agents (also called Customs Brokers) file Bills of Entry, Shipping Bills, and related customs documentation on ICEGATE on behalf of importers and exporters. Because ICEGATE encrypts these documents during transmission, filing requires a Class 3 Combo DSC (Signing + Encryption), the same requirement that applies to importers and exporters filing directly.

A Signing-only DSC will not work for ICEGATE filing, this is one of the most common mistakes CHAs (and first-time exporters) make when buying a DSC without checking first.

Whose name does the DSC go in?

The Combo DSC is typically issued to the CHA firm's authorized representative, the individual named on the CHA licence, or the firm's authorized signatory if filing under a company structure. It's worth confirming with your specific customs house or ICEGATE registration requirements which name and entity structure applies to your licence.

What else CHAs commonly need

Many CHAs also handle filings on behalf of multiple client businesses, if you're filing under your own CHA licence on behalf of clients (rather than each client having their own DSC), one Combo DSC registered against your CHA credentials generally covers your filing activity, check with ICEGATE support if you're unsure how your specific licence structure maps to DSC requirements.
